     Clara Jane Allison was buried at Park Hill Cemetery, 1105 South Morris Avenue, Bloomington, McLean Co., Illinois.2 She Miss Clara Jane Allison, 22, 212 East Front street, died at Brokaw hospital at 9:40 a.m. Monday after suffering a broken neck when she fell from a tractor driven by Dana Clark, Towanda, Saturday afternoon. Coroner Roy I. McClellan was to hold an inquest into the death at 3:30 p.m. today. The inquest will be held at the Beck Memorial home where the body was taken. Mrs. Alison was born Nov. 24, 1923, in Oakmont, Pa. She was a former resident of the Illinois Soldiers and Sailors Children School and had attended University High School. She is survived by her parents, Mrs. Edmond Sage and Everett Alison, and her step parents, Edmund Sage and Mrs. Everett Alison. Mr. and Mrs. Sage reside at 212 East Front street, and Mr. and Mrs. Allison are residents of Cleveland, Ohio. Also surviving are three brothers, Everett D. Allison Jr., Chicago; Lawrence F. Allison, Clearwater, Calif., and John C. Allison U.S. navy, and one sister, Mrs. Walter Burroughs, 212 East Front street.3 Her Social Security Number was 353-18-6819.1 She was born on November 24, 1923 at Oakmont, Allegheny Co., Pennsylvania.1,2,3 She died on April 8, 1946 at Normal, McLean Co., Illinois, at age 22.1,2

     Harry Carlyle Hickson was buried at Lauderdale Memorial Park, Fort Lauderdale, Broward Co., Florida.2 He married Sarah Ruth Allison, daughter of James Whitehill Allison and Buena Vista Davis.1 Harry Carlyle Hickson was born on April 19, 1902 at Donaldsonville, Seminole Co., Georgia.3 He died on August 3, 1983 at Fort Lauderdale, Broward Co., Florida, at age 81.2 He FORT LAUDERDALE - Harry C. Hickson, the city's chief building inspector for 30 years and known for his outspoken independence, died Wednesday at Northridge Hospital. He was 81 and a resident of the city for more than 60 years. Hickson, hired as the chief building inspector in 1936, served in that post until his retirement in 1968, except for a two-year absence during World War II when he worked for private industry in Miami and West Palm Beach. He attempted briefly to stay on in the position after the city's mandatory retirement age of 65. A Donalsonville, Ga. native, Hickson made a name for himself in Fort Lauderdale during its formative years by speaking his mind. At one point, he was fired and rehired three times during a two-week period. He battled in court with a mayor over a dispute about plastic pipe and boldly issued a warrant against a prominent citizen's wife for violating a zoning ordinance. City commissioners subsequently rewrote the ordinance. "I never let the City Commission or city manager make a decision in this office," he said in a 1968 interview. "I didn't want to share the authority or responsibility of the office since I was responsible for it" At his own retirement luncheon, he said his middle initial "C" stood for "controversial." "I kept the politicians off my hip, and I think we built a pretty nice city," he said. Then City Manager Robert Bubier, while presenting a plaque to Hickson at the luncheon, said Hickson "has given me a lot of good advice in his own way." His independent nature also led him at one point to not say anything at all. He went 16 months without saying a word to one city manager he didn't like, even though the city manager was his boss. Hickson also found time to hold memberships in the Doric Masonic Lodge 140, F.&A.M., the Mahi Shrine Temple of Miami and the Keystone Chapter of Lauderdale Council Melita Commandry. He was a retired 50-year member and past president of the Carpenter's Union Local 1394. Hickson is survived by his wife, Marya; a son, Durwood Hickson of Nairobi, Kenya; a daughter, Fleurette Gistinelli of Delray Beach; a stepson, Alan Clark of Wilton Manors; stepdaughters Karen Jacob of Tuscaloosa, Ala., Sue Tutison of Ramona, Calif, and Kay Liska of Virginia; a brother, three sisters, several grandchildren and several great-grandchildren.
